How to Examine Pet Dog Daycare
A respectable daycare will certainly call for canines to be up-to-date on their inoculations & have a titer test done. They should additionally guarantee their employee are learnt family pet first aid & MOUTH-TO-MOUTH RESUSCITATION.
In addition, they must have a low staff-to-dog proportion to ensure that each pet dog is effectively cared for and kept track of. The center must be tidy and well ventilated.
1. Inspect the Center
Just like you wouldn't send your children to institution without a personal excursion, you must see the childcare center prior to leaving your dog there. Check the kennels and play areas to see how clean they are. Ask what procedures they have in place to avoid injuries and how they deal with behavioral problems.
A respectable day care will certainly have lots of outside locations for canines to be active in and play easily. Make certain they have a procedure for breaking up scuffles and utilize only favorable support techniques that are verified to be secure and reliable for the pets. They must likewise have a clear event assessment process and connect well with animal parents about any kind of cases that take place at the center. Warning consist of not interacting about any kind of cases, not examining the canines after an event, and using methods like force or water to break up scuffles that might create injury. These techniques are old and clinically verified to be harmful for canines, both physically and mentally.
2. Ask Inquiries
Asking inquiries is just one of the most important things you can do when searching for pet childcare. Whether it has to do with safety protocols, personnel certifications, or everyday routines, obtaining clear responses furnishes you with an alternative understanding of the center.
Ask about the childcare's strategy to food timetables, pause, and enrichment tasks, as these are crucial elements of your canines general care. Additionally, a respectable facility ought to offer openness in their day-to-day treatments by offering a webcam and offering tours.
You can also inquire about the childcare's testing procedures and exactly how they figure out if your pet is appropriate for their team (e.g., personality examinations, play groups based on size and play design). Additionally, inquire about emergency situation gain access to as you wish to know that they have a strategy in luxury dog boarding near me position for circumstances that occur such as fights or wellness dilemmas. Ask about what pet clinical training and accreditations their employees have, too.
3. Take an Excursion
A high quality daycare relies upon repeat customers, so take some time to see the center. Try to find windows or sites that supply a view right into the childcare space and the kennels. Watch for warnings like a filthy facility or irregular cleaning timetable. Eco-friendly flags include a plainly detailed daily process and a staff-to-dog proportion that allows for customized interest.
Ask what education or training the team has in animal actions and dog training. A respectable childcare should have protocols in position for taking care of conflict and hostility in between canines along with for managing overstimulation during team play.
It's additionally a good concept to chat with present consumers and obtain their comments. This can offer you understanding right into the advantages and disadvantages of a certain daycare and help you make a more educated choice that straightens with your pet's needs and expectations. A solid recommendation from a completely satisfied client is a powerful selling point. Furthermore, adverse responses can alert you to possible problems.
